What do car enthusiasts call themselves?

People who love cars — people who really, really love cars — have a language all their own. We call these people “gearheads” (“petrol heads” in the UK), and while we are sometime among their numbers, more often we are listening to their secret lingo and saying “Wha?”

What is a Subaru 360?

The Subaru 360 is a rear-engined, two-door city car manufactured and marketed from 1958 to 1971 by Subaru. As the company’s first automobile, production reached 392,000 over its 12-year model run. The 360’s overall size and engine capacity complied with Japan’s Kei car regulations.
